Eight Years of NCLA Litigation Brings End to SEC and CFTC’s Gag Rules that Silenced Americans

Thomas J. Powell, et al. v. Securities and Exchange Commission Washington, D.C., June 29, 2026 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- After eight years of relentless effort, the New Civil Liberties Alliance has gotten rid of the unconstitutional Gag Rules issued by the Securities and Exchange Commission and Commodity Futures Trading Commission.
